Question
1. A flower shop is a shop where people buy flowers.
2. A flower shop is a shop where people buy a flower.
3. A flower shop is a shop that people buy flowers.
4. A flower shop is a shop people buy flowers.
5. A flower shop is a shop people buy some flowers.
------------------------
#1 is correct. What about the others? In the exam, are they regarded as correct answers or not?

Answers
Marylyn
I think 2 is correct as well. But the others seem off.
Writeacher
Right. 1 and 2 are correct, but the others are not.
3 would be correct if you replace "that" with "in which" but 4 and 5 are simply run on sentences.
